
For evaluation, single-axis motherboards are available for various fieldbuses.
A PCI Express connector allows for fast and easy integration into a customer-specific board – thus offering a compact and affordable solution that reduces the wiring effort, particularly for multi-axis applications.
The NP5 controller can control motors with a rated current of up to 6 A via FOC, Hall sensors, or sensorless control. In addition to position, speed, and torque control, operating modes with cyclical set value specification are also available for interpolated multi-axis operation.
For parameterization and programming Nanotec offers the free Plug & Drive Studio software. The NP5 can be connected to a higher-level controller via SPI, EtherCAT, Modbus RTU, or CANopen.
In addition, the controller can be programmed in the NanoJ V2 programming language so that time-critical subtasks can be executed directly in the controller, independently of the fieldbus communication.
